How Outpatient Alcohol and Drug Treatment Works in Arcola, Indiana

If you have been battling with a severe substance use disorder and addiction, outpatient alcohol and drug rehabilitation may not prove to be enough for you. Before you seek treatment for your addiction, you must first complete detoxification to rid your body completely of the substances you were abusing.

After the detox stage, the outpatient addiction treatment facility will start the official work of therapy and recovery. In fact, these programs work best if you have already completed another form of care - such as a staying in an inpatient alcohol and drug rehab. You should also be considered medically stable enough that you can easily pursue treatment and recovery with little to no supervision.

When you begin an outpatient drug and alcohol treatment program in Arcola, the following services will be provided every week:

  • Therapy sessions with Family
  • Group therapy and support meetings
  • One-on-one counseling
  • Organization and management of prescribed medications for co-occurring disorders
  • Diet Management
  • One to one counseling and therapy with trained addiction treatment and/or mental health expert
  • Recreational therapy
  • Relapse Prevention Skills
  • Sober living housing, where required

Since outpatient treatment does not require that you live inside the facility, it means that you might need to dedicate yourself to recovery so that the program proves fruitful in the long run. You should also desire sobriety and abstain from drugs without any supervision or care.

As long as your living situation and environment is conducive to your recovery, you might find that outpatient alcohol and drug treatment is the best option. This is because you will get support and care at home so that you can carry on focusing on overcoming your addiction - with none of the temptations you may have run into in the past.
